It appears that the transformation from shape 1 to shape 2 is a 90 degree clockwise rotation about the origin. It is clockwise because 1 moves to 2 in the direction of a clock, and since it moves 1 quadrant it is 90 degrees.
Look at the corner of shape 1 at (-1,3). If you rotate the shape, the new point is at (3,1). This follows the formula that shows a 90 degree clockwise rotation: (x,y)⇒(y,-x).
